Historical or Topical Context


The story of Inside Out takes place in a variety of settings, as it follows the life and experiences of actress Demi Moore. The book begins with her childhood in Roswell, New Mexico where she was born into a troubled family. Her parents' marriage was tumultuous and they moved frequently, causing instability in Moore's early years. This setting provides insight into the challenges and difficulties that shaped her formative years.

As Moore's career took off, the setting shifts to Hollywood where she experienced immense success as an actress. However, behind the glitz and glamour of Hollywood lies a dark underbelly that is often hidden from public view. It is within this setting that Moore faced intense pressure to conform to societal standards of beauty and perfection, leading to struggles with body image and addiction. Through her honest portrayal of this world, readers are given a glimpse into the harsh realities that exist beneath the surface in the entertainment industry.

Description

INSTANT #1 NEW YORK TIMES BESTSELLER

A Best Book of the Year: The New Yorker, The Guardian, The Sunday Times, The Daily Mail, Good Morning America, She Reads

Famed American actress Demi Moore at last tells her own story in a surprisingly intimate and emotionally charged memoir that is “equal parts adversity and resilience, told with candor” (USA Today).

For decades, Demi Moore has been synonymous with celebrity. From iconic film roles to high-profile relationships, Moore has never been far from the spotlight—or the headlines.

Even as Demi was becoming the highest paid actress in Hollywood, however, she was always outrunning her past, just one step ahead of the doubts and insecurities that defined her childhood. Throughout her rise to fame and during some of the most pivotal moments of her life, Demi battled addiction, body image issues, and childhood trauma that would follow her for years—all while juggling a skyrocketing career and at times negative public perception. As her success grew, Demi found herself questioning if she belonged in Hollywood, if she was a good mother, a good actress—and, always, if she was simply good enough.

As much as her story is about adversity, it is also about tremendous resilience. In this deeply candid and reflective memoir, Demi pulls back the curtain and opens up about her career and personal life—laying bare her tumultuous relationship with her mother, her marriages, her struggles balancing stardom with raising a family, and her journey toward open heartedness. Inside Out is a story of survival, success, and surrender—a wrenchingly honest portrayal of one woman’s at once ordinary and iconic life.
